General description

The DMABA NHS ester reagents were developed by Dr. Robert Murphy′s laboratory at the University of Colorado in order to create PE derivatives where all subclasses and potentially oxidized products could be universally detected using a common precursor ion in the positive ion mode by Mass Spectrometry.

Biochem/physiol Actions

DMABA-d0 NHS Ester, deuterium enriched 4-(dimethylamino) benzoic acid (DMABA) N-hydroxysuccinimide (NHS) ester reagents (d0) is used for derivatizing the primary amine group of lipids, such as glycerophosphoethanolamine (PE) lipid species and differential labeling. It enables detection of phosphatidylethanolamine subclasses in biological samples.
